static void Main(string[] args) { Person p1 = new Person() { Name = "Søren" }; Personer1 personer1 = new Personer1(); personer1.Tilføj(p1); Console.WriteLine("" + personer1.Name); Console.ReadKey(); }
static void Main(string[] args) { //Udkommenterede linjer kode vil skabe errors Personer1 p1 = new Personer1(); p1.Tilføj(new Person { Navn = "Søren" }); p1.Tilføj(new Instruktør { Navn = "Theis" }); p1.Tilføj(new Kursist { Navn = "Iben" }); //p1.Tilføj(1); Personer2 <Person> p2 = new Personer2 <Person>(); p2.Tilføj(new Person { Navn = "Søren" }); p2.Tilføj(new Instruktør { Navn = "Theis" }); p2.Tilføj(new Kursist { Navn = "Iben" }); Personer2 <int> p21 = new Personer2 <int>(); p21.Tilføj(1); p21.Tilføj(2); p21.Tilføj(3); Personer3 <Kursist> p3 = new Personer3 <Kursist>(); //p3.Tilføj(new Person { Navn = "Søren" }); //p3.Tilføj(new Instruktør { Navn = "Theis" }); p3.Tilføj(new Kursist { Navn = "Iben" }); //Personer3<int> p31 = new Personer3<int>(); Personer3 <Person> p32 = new Personer3 <Person>(); p32.Tilføj(new Person { Navn = "Søren" }); p32.Tilføj(new Instruktør { Navn = "Theis" }); p32.Tilføj(new Kursist { Navn = "Iben" }); if (System.Diagnostics.Debugger.IsAttached) { Console.Write("Press any key to continue . . . "); Console.ReadKey(); } }